Press Release

NASA FINDS OCEAN WATER ON MARS!
LONG JOHN SILVER'S GIVES AMERICA FREE GIANT SHRIMP TO CELEBRATE

***

Long John Silver's President Calls Discovery
"One Small Step for Man, One Giant Leap for Giant Shrimp"

March 24, 2004

LOUISVILLE, KY - NASA's March 23
announcement of evidence of the past presence of "a body of gently
flowing sal****er" on Mars is big news for America, and giant news
for seafood fans.

In January, Long John Silver's offered to give America free Giant
Shrimp if NASA found conclusive evidence of an ocean on Mars. To
celebrate the success of NASA's Mars Rover project, the company
is going to give America free Giant Shrimp on Monday, May 10.

"This is the big announcement that Long John Silver's has been
waiting for since January - that there is evidence of a past salty sea
on Mars," said Mike Baker, Chief Marketing Officer for Long John
Silver's, Inc. "We can't wait to celebrate NASA's
out-of-this-world success, and there's no better way to recognize
their giant accomplishments than with free Giant Shrimp for
America."

On Monday, May 10, between the hours of 2 p.m. and 5 p.m., customers
can stop by any participating Long John Silver's restaurant and enjoy a
free Giant Shrimp (one piece per customer).

Long John Silver's President Steve Davis sent a personal letter to
NASA Administrator Sean O'Keefe, congratulating NASA on their
discovery.

"We've been following the Mars Exploration project since the beginning,"
Davis wrote, "and we've been anxiously awaiting word of evidence of an
ocean on Mars. The rovers have been extremely busy since they arrived
on Mars - they've had 'plenty of things on their plate.' Now, with the
discovery of ocean water, America can add one more thing to its plate -
free Giant Shrimp."

Davis ended the letter by writing, "This is one small step for man, and
one giant leap for Giant Shrimp." He also again expressed interest in
Long John Silver's becoming the first seafood restaurant on Mars.

Baker added that the Giant Shrimp giveaway is the perfect way to
celebrate NASA's historic discovery, which has taken place at the same
time Long John Silver's Giant Shrimp introduction has been one of the
most successful product launches in company history.

"NASA is making history on Mars and Long John Silver's is making history
here on earth," added Baker. "Our faith in NASA has paid off. Their
giant accomplishment calls for Giant Shrimp."

The new Giant Shrimp are the largest shrimp Long John Silver's has ever
served. They feature the great-tasting secret batter that has made Long
John Silver's famous for fish, shrimp and chicken for 35 years.

Every person in the U.S. will have an opportunity to obtain one free
Giant Shrimp at participating Long John Silver's restaurants in the
United States. Redemption will take place on Monday, May 10, 2004,
from 2 p.m. until 5 p.m., local time, while supplies last. Customers
can use the store locator at www.ljsilvers.com to find their nearest
Long John Silver's locations.
